#406293 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#406293 is composed of 25.1% red, 38.4%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.5%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 215.4 degrees, a saturation of 39.3% and a lightness of 41.4%. #406293 color hex could be obtained by blending #80c4ff with #000027.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#406293 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#406293 has RGB values of R:64, G:98,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 4219539.
